Basic Steps to update Magento 2 - 3 Simple Ways to Upgrade
There are five basic steps to update Magento 2 store.
Step 1: Take Complete Backup of your store
Step 2: Enable maintenance mode
Step 3: Select Magento 2 Version
Step 4: Run Composer update Command
Step 5: Check the current Magento 2’s version

Step 1: Change The Store Mode
In order to upgrade the magento store, you have to change the mode into maintenance.
php bin/magento maintenance:enable
Step 2: Mention Your Version
composer require <product> <version> —no-update
Now run the below command
composer update
Example:
Suppose you want to upgrade your Magento 2 store to Magento 2 CE 2.4.3-p1 Then use the command as in the example:
composer require magento/product-community-edition 2.4.3 —no-update
Then,
composer update
Similarly, you can follow this step to upgrade to any version of the Magento store.
Now run the below command
php bin/magento setup:upgrade php bin/magento setup:static-content:deploy php bin/magento cache:clean php bin/magento indexer:reindex
Step 3. Disable the Maintenance Mode
Now, you can disable the maintenance mode and put your store back to work by running the command:
php bin/magento maintenance:disable
Method 2: Upgrade Magento 2 Store Manually
The third way is to go to the Magento store and download the latest Magento version from there.
Then extract it and paste it in the root directory of your Magento store and if any file or folder is asking to replace then replace it.
After this, now you run the setup upgrade command, then compile it and then deploy it.
After this do the indexing, now you flush all the cache of the store, your store has been upgraded.
php bin/magento setup:upgrade php bin/magento setup:static-content:deploy php bin/magento cache:clean php bin/magento indexer:reindex
If even after this your store is not showing Upgraded then run the below command and then run all the above commands one by one.
Now you can check your Magento 2 store by opening the browser you can see that your store has been upgraded without internet.
rm -rf var/cache/ var/generation/ var/page_cache/ var/view_preprocessed/
And then run above command again.
Method 3: Web Step Wizard Upgradation
Now the last method is to use the web setup wizard for the up-gradation.
This upgrade step is simple for those who are not able to use Magento 2 Composer in a better way.
Step 1: Login into Magento 2 Admin
For this, you have to log in to your magento 2 admin and go to system tools and click on the web setup wizard.
You should have administrator access for your admin user.
System > Tools > Web Setup Wizard
Step 2. Fill System Configuration Details
Now you have to enter the authentication key of the marketplace, after that, you have to save and proceed to the next stage.
Step 3. Save config and then System Upgrades
In the meantime, the Marketplace may ask you to update other technologies and tools, such as updating the PHP version.
And may also ask you to update your database version.
For this, it is better that you keep both versions updated only then you can go to the next step.
Note: Please take backup of your store before upgradation.
Check Store Version - 3 Simple Ways to Upgrade
Now you can check the store version via the following Magento 2 command.
php bin/magento --version
